Transaction

2333099f040aa35dd163e086ab0f8ee09a835da7decf429d036e45d0392cdee2

Summary

In Block743701
TimeSun, 16 Jun 2024 17:49:30 UTC
Total Input2448.5524353 Nebula
Total Output2448.5523717 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
139799 Confirmations2448.5523717 Nebula
Raw Transaction